Tough to do this, but I gotta move an amp. 1964 Gibson Mercury Head for sale, very clean for a 40 + year old amp. 2 channels, pretty much a crank it and go amp. Great 70s rock vibe, Not high gain, but very nice crunch. Filter caps have been replaced. It is a loud one, around 50 watts. Gigged several times, has worked very nicely. It has 4 inputs, 2 on each channel. PTP construction. 6l6, 6EU7 based amp. Selling it cheap!! Only 400 + of these amps made. 275.00 + 30.00 to pack and ship in the USA.
